Linux系统中查找文件的命令技巧

需积分: 0 0 下载量 138 浏览量 更新于2024-07-11 收藏 454KB PPT 举报
"这篇文档主要介绍了在Unix和Linux操作系统中如何通过文件名进行查找,以及Linux系统的常用命令和使用方式。" 在Unix和Linux系统中,查找文件是日常操作的重要部分。当我们知道文件的部分或完整名称,但不确定它位于哪个目录下时,可以使用`find`命令来定位文件。以下是如何使用`find`命令的详细步骤: 1. **通过文件名查找** 假设你要找的文件名为`httpd.conf`,你可以使用以下命令: ``` find / -name httpd.conf -print ``` 这个命令从根目录(`/`)开始搜索,查找名为`httpd.conf`的文件,并打印出找到的文件路径。 2. **根据部分文件名查找** 如果你只记得文件名的一部分,例如包含`http`的文件,可以使用通配符来辅助查找: ``` find / -name *http* -print ``` 这里的`*`是一个通配符,代表任意数量的任意字符,所以`*http*`会匹配所有包含`http`的文件名。 除了文件查找,Linux系统提供了丰富的命令集,涵盖多个方面: **命令的使用方式** - 在Linux中,用户可以通过终端来执行命令。打开终端的方法包括:通过桌面菜单或者右键快捷菜单启动。 - 不同用户登录后的提示符可能不同,普通用户和超级用户的提示符有所区别。 - 输入命令时,回车键表示输入结束,回车符(CONTROL-m)和DELETE键在不同场景下有不同作用。 - 控制键如CTRL-d表示输入结束,CTRL-g使终端响铃,CTRL-h是退格键,用于修改输入。 **文件及目录操作命令** - 包括`cd`用于切换目录,`ls`列出目录内容,`mkdir`创建目录,`rm`删除文件或目录,`mv`移动或重命名文件和目录,`cp`复制文件和目录等。 **文件压缩命令** - Linux中常见的压缩和解压缩命令有`gzip`、`bzip2`、`tar`等,可以对文件或目录进行压缩和打包。 **联机帮助命令** - `man`命令提供在线帮助,如`man find`可以查看`find`命令的使用手册。 **进程管理的命令** - 包括`ps`查看当前进程,`kill`发送信号结束进程,`top`实时监控系统进程状态,`nohup`让命令在后台持续运行。 了解并熟练掌握这些命令,将大大提高在Unix和Linux环境中的工作效率。记住,每个命令都有其特定的语法和选项,使用`man`命令可以随时查阅详细信息。在实际操作中,不断实践和探索,将有助于深入理解Linux系统及其工作原理。